Determining which state has jurisdiction in a child custody matter is a fact-driven process guided by the Uniform Child Custody Jurisdiction and Enforcement Act (UCCJEA). It is vital your family law attorney fully understand this federal act that can have a huge impact on parenting time, relocations and other outcomes in a divorce.

Marital settlement agreements involving interstate custody issues are complex matters. It is common for judges from the respective states to discuss the facts they need to know in order to make the crucial decision about which state's divorce laws will apply. As such it is important to ensure the courts receive all the relevant information required to apply and enforce UCCJEA jurisdiction, especially in a military divorce.

UCCJEA plays a major role in military family law, particularly in child custody problems involving military members stationed across the country and or deployed overseas. I know the special considerations my military clients need, e.g. where they may file for divorce and the child's home state (where they have lived for six consecutive months prior to the start of divorce proceedings).
